Overview

Edge AI for Smart Cities Training is a focused two-day program designed to help professionals understand how deploying artificial intelligence at the edge enables real-time, scalable, and secure smart city solutions. This course explores how Edge AI supports intelligent urban infrastructure, traffic management, public safety, energy optimization, and citizen services by processing data locally from sensors, cameras, and IoT devices, enabling faster decision-making and improved urban efficiency.

Course Outline

Introduction to Edge AI for Smart Cities
โ€ข Definition and scope of Edge AI in urban environments
โ€ข Difference between cloud-based and edge-based smart city AI
โ€ข Benefits of low latency, scalability, and resilience
โ€ข Overview of smart city Edge AI use cases

Smart City Edge Architecture and Infrastructure
โ€ข Urban IoT devices, sensors, and edge nodes
โ€ข Cameras, traffic systems, and environmental sensors
โ€ข Data flow between edge, control centers, and cloud
โ€ข Infrastructure design and deployment considerations

AI Models for Smart City Edge Applications
โ€ข Selecting models suitable for city-scale edge environments
โ€ข Accuracy, latency, and scalability trade-offs
โ€ข Computer vision and signal processing at the edge
โ€ข Evaluating performance in real-world urban conditions

Deployment, Optimization, and Operations
โ€ข Model optimization for large-scale edge deployments
โ€ข Managing updates and lifecycle of edge AI systems
โ€ข Monitoring performance and operational reliability
โ€ข Integrating Edge AI with existing city platforms

Privacy, Security, and Governance
โ€ข Citizen data privacy and responsible AI usage
โ€ข Security challenges in city-wide edge systems
โ€ข Policy, compliance, and governance considerations
โ€ข Building public trust in smart city AI initiatives

Smart City Use Cases and Future Trends
โ€ข Intelligent traffic and mobility management
โ€ข Public safety and surveillance analytics
โ€ข Smart energy, utilities, and sustainability
โ€ข Future directions of Edge AI in smart urban ecosystems
